The lesson includes a greatest common divisor program, but then shows you that Python includes a math module with a function that will do this. What is the module and how is it added to your code?(1 point)

Responses

Fractions module; On line 1, import it with the following:

import fractions

Fractions module; On line 1, import it with the following: import fractions

Math module; No need to import, it is automatically included with Python
Math module; No need to import, it is automatically included with Python

GCD module; On line 1, import it with the following:

import gcd

GCD module; On line 1, import it with the following: import gcd

Math module; On line 1, import it with the following:

import math

Math module; On line 1, import it with the following: import math
Question 2
What would the output be for the following program?

import math
num1 = 64
num2 = math.sqrt(num1) // (88 % 7 - 1)
print(num2)

(1 point)
Responses

2
2

8
8

0.75
0.75

2.0
2.0

1 answer

For the first question, the correct response is:

Math module; On line 1, import it with the following:

import math

For the second question, let's evaluate the code step by step:

import math
num1 = 64
num2 = math.sqrt(num1) // (88 % 7 - 1)
print(num2)
  1. math.sqrt(num1) calculates the square root of 64, which is 8.0.
  2. 88 % 7 calculates the remainder of 88 divided by 7, which is 4 (since 88 = 12 * 7 + 4).
  3. We then do 88 % 7 - 1, which is 4 - 1, resulting in 3.
  4. Now we have num2 = 8.0 // 3. The // operator performs floor division.
  5. When we perform floor division between 8.0 and 3, the result is 2.0.

Thus, the output of the program will be:

2.0